WebAug 1, 2024 · Spider monkeys are one of a handful of primates living in fission-fusion , a social dynamic defined by separations and reunions. Embraces are a contact greeting gesture that occur at the time of reunions in spider monkeys . In the standard embrace, the hands are wrapped around the body and the face is placed along the trunk [7,8]. Webto spider monkeys. WebJun 14, 2024 · Black spider monkeys are a very important part of tropical forest ecosystems. Black spider monkeys have an important role in seed dispersal and help spread out seeds. This helps the forests grow and flourish, which in turn helps black spider monkeys and all the other animals that call the incredible tropical forests their home. … WebApr 11, 2024 · spider monkey, (genus Ateles ), large, extremely agile monkey that lives in forests from southern Mexico through Central and South America to Brazil. WebMar 7, 2024 · This subspecies of the spider monkey is one of three types of spider monkeys in Panama. Brown Pelican at the beach on the Azuero Peninsula in Panama. In 2013, a population survey estimated there were a mere 145 Azuero spider monkeys left in the wild, making them one of South America’s rarest animals.
